Handover — Vexler partner SFTP drop

Ownership moves to you today. Drop runs hourly from Vexler's end into the intake bucket via the relay host. Watch for zero-byte files; their exporter flakes on Mondays. Creds live in the ops vault, path noted in the runbook. Vault auto-seals after 48h idle. Support escalations go to the on-call rotation, not me. If the vault is sealed when you need it, unseal with the recovery passphrase below.

recovery phrase for tadug-fafof: zorwyn-kasion

## Deploying the Gatewick Proctor Queue

Deploys are pretty painless: push to main, wait for the pipeline, then watch the queue drain dashboard for five minutes. If candidates pile up mid-exam, roll back first and ask questions later — the queue replays safely. Everything the workers care about lives in one config block, shown here for reference.

settings of bafof-yagef:
JOROX_PIN=8740
JOROX_TENANT=pelox
JOROX_METRICS_HOST=metrics.jorox.qorvelworks.internal
JOROX_SEAL=seal_c78f63c1
JOROX_STANDBY_TEAM=norax

## Welcome to FareForge

Hey! FareForge is our rules engine for shipping fees — it decides whether an order from, say, Port Ilvane gets flat-rate or zone-based pricing. As release manager, you'll cut a tagged build every other Thursday. The rules DSL compiles into a bundle that ships to the edge nodes, and each bundle has to be signed or the nodes will quietly ignore it (ask Tobin how we learned that). Sign each bundle with the key below.

rollout seal: bky4_x7Gc